This project was intended to be a part of a backend server used for verification and authentication of a user's ownership to his Roblox account.
That would be probably the better choice since it would be a lot more efficient. But the problem here is that if you wanted to operate properly using the Roblox API, which could be a hassle since you will need to rent a VPS. That's where Blxscrape comes into play.
It uses Puppeteer which is a bot controlled browser that does everything automatically. It logs into Roblox using the credentials you provide in the .env file. Then it goes to the URL of the user's profile that you've provided, and then it will fetch the username, description and the user's profile picture URL, if the user does not already exist, it will save the data to a JSON file.
